The Chicago, Illinois Police Department requests funding for 100 officers to access FranklinCovey's All Access Pass, which would allow participants to gain access to FranklinCovey training content, including Policing at the Speed of Trust, Leading at the Speed of Trust, and 7 Habits of Highly Effective People for Law Enforcement.

The Newark, New Jersey Police Department, as part of the Newark Public Safety Partnership (PSP) site, requested assistance in developing a use of force training curriculum that incorporates best practices and is in line with currently New Jersey and national laws. BJA NTTAC is working with the Newark PSP site to determine budget availability, this request will not be fulfilled by BJA NTTAC during the base year.

The Baltimore, Maryland Police Department (PD) requested an assessment of its crime-fighting strategies and tactics. Strategic Focus, LLC President, Dr. Malinowski, and his team of subject matter experts were selected as the providers.

The University of Chicago Crime Lab requested travel support for participants to travel to and attend the second Early Intervention System (EIS) National Advisory Committee (NAC) meeting. BJA NTTAC provided travel support for 18 participants to attend the second EIS NAC meeting on August 24 – 25, 2017 in Chicago, Illinois.

The University of Chicago Crime Lab requested funding support for the Strategic Decision Support Centers Crimefighters Conference. BJA NTTAC provided funding for books and instructional videos in support of the conference, which took place on July 20, 2017 in Chicago, Illinois.

The Bureau of Justice Assistance requested travel support for representatives from the Public Safety Partnership (PSP) sites to attend the International Association of Crime Analysts (IACA) Annual Conference. BJA NTTAC will provide travel support to 30 representatives to attend the IACA Conference from September 10 – 15 2017 in New Orleans, Louisiana.

The Chicago, Illinois Police Department (PD) requested that Arif Alikhan prepare and deliver a presentation at the Strategic Decision Support Centers Crimefighters Conference. Mr. Alikhan delivered a presentation on constitutional policing on July 20, 2017 in Chicago, Illinois.
